The appliance must be disconnected from the
supply mains when removing the battery.
The battery is to be disposed of safely.
Details on how to remove the battery:
1. Turn off and unplug the fan before disassemble.
2. Remove the base bolts with an Allen wrench to separate
the column.
3. Remove the foot pad with a sharp tool, and then use a
Phillips-head screwdriver to remove the the base screws.
4. Detach the upper cover of the base.
5. Use a Phillips-head screwdriver to remove the screws on the
battery compartment cover. Remove the cover and take out the
lithium battery.
Safety instructions
Precautions
Handling
Always turn the fan off and unplug it before moving it.
Hold the fan column firmly to prevent falling and personal injuries.
Installation
Be sure to properly install the product according to the instructions
to avoid electric shocks, fire hazards, personal injuries, and any other
accidents.
When installing and dismantling the device, be sure to first disconnect
the power.This fan contains a battery. When assembling the unit,
mount the fan cover and fan blades first, and then assemble the base
to prevent the fan from starting accidentally and causing mechanical
hazards.
In use
If you encounter any of the following: abnormal sound, strange
odor, high temperature, inconsistent fan rotation, etc., stop the fan
immediately.
Do not lean on the fan or tilt the fan while it is running.
Do not dismantle the device by yourself. In case repair or consultation
is needed, please contact Smartmi customer service.
Adapter
To avoid fire, electric shocks, or other damage,use the power adapter and
electrical outlet as instructed below:
Do not excessively pull, twist or bend the power adapter, as this may
expose or break the cord's core.
The power adapter must be plugged into a suitable electrical outlet.
Use the power adapter that is provided with the fan, do not use any third
party power adapters.
Always unplug the fan before carrying out maintenance to or moving the fan.
